          Doyle Reese wrote:I ask this because at the moment, it is very obvious at determining the borders of the Outpost and where it connects with the rest of the map as it is a giant square on the overhead map that looks incredibly out of place  
  One of the things that I have been talking with our environment team about is that they need to:
  1. Make more interesting and non flat terrain inside the sockets (especially large ones) and, 2. Not flatten the terrain beneath the location of the socket because it defeats the purpose of the terrain blending which ends up causing exactly what you are talking about. Very obvious borders of terrain.
